Key Elements of a Personal Injury Claim in Texas
To pursue a successful personal injury claim in West University Place, you must establish four critical elements: duty of care, breach of that duty, causation, and damages. Texas follows a modified comparative fault rule, meaning that your compensation may be reduced by your percentage of fault. If you are found to be more than 50% responsible for the accident, you are barred from recovering any damages. Additionally, Texas imposes a two-year statute of limitations on personal injury claims, making timely action critical.
Damages in a personal injury case can include med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and diminished quality of life. Given the high property values and cost of living in West University Place, economic losses from an injury can be substantial, making it all the more important to document every aspect of your claim thoroughly.

Your Right to Seek Compensation
Under Texas personal injury law, individuals who suffer harm due to another party’s negligence have the right to pursue financial compensation. This includes damages for med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and property damage. In West University Place, common personal injury cases arise from car accidents on busy roads like Bissonnet Street and Weslayan Street, slip-and-fall incidents at local businesses, and dog bite injuries in residential neighborhoods. Texas follows a modified comparative fault rule, meaning you can recover damages as long as you are not more than 50 percent responsible for the accident.
Statute of Limitations in Texas
It is important to act promptly after sustaining a personal injury. In Texas, the statute of limitations for most personal injury claims is two years from the date of the injury. Failing to file within this window can result in losing your right to pursue compensation entirely. For West University Place residents, this means that whether your incident occurred near the West University Elementary School zone or along Buffalo Speedway, time is a critical factor in protecting your legal interests.
